What Is Obsidian?
Obsidian is volcanic glass formed from the rapid cooling of molten lava. Though it shares the same minerals as granite, the quick cooling prevents the formation of a crystalline structure, making obsidian smooth as glass. While typically black, obsidian comes in various colors and forms, reflecting its diverse origins from volcanic eruptions around the world.
Where It's Found:
Obsidian can be found in Mexico, the United States, Armenia, Turkey, Iceland, and Japan.
